Output fd80bf7ec95e5f04e2d8e34783611a3d6efea868b28f2c115445ef56720291d8:0

value
969828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3c21754ce45a4732608bc04c0d5d66612b9de87 OP_EQUAL
address
3J5VPa1yZfo8Vor7VDdh7vwE4pEzkzRQ4R
transaction
fd80bf7ec95e5f04e2d8e34783611a3d6efea868b28f2c115445ef56720291d8
spent
true